To the Saffir-Simpson Hurricane Wind Scale, a major hurricane implies a Category three or greater. The scale involves 5 categories according to the storm's sustained wind speeds. Furthermore, it estimates likely damage to property, starting from "some damage" to "catastrophic." After roaring with the Keys, the hurricane turned gradually northward
